$50,000 Winning CT POWERBALL Ticket Sold In Westport

A Weston resident is the lucky winner, according to the Connecticut Lottery.

WESTPORT, CT — A Weston resident is $50,000 richer this week after claiming a winning POWERBALL lottery ticket she purchased in Westport, the Connecticut Lottery announced.

On Monday, Rachelle Glick claimed the winning ticket she purchased at Westport Amoco on the Post Road East.

The national game costs at least $2 per ticket, and has an increasing jackpot in the millions. To win the jackpot, a player must match five "white ball" numbers between 1 and 69, and one "red ball" number between 1 and 26.

For a player to win $50,000, they must match four white ball numbers and the red ball number; the odds for doing so are 1 in 913,129, according to lottery officials.
